In "The Ride to the Lady, and Other Poems, " Helen Gray Cone weaves a tapestry of lyrical verse that explores the complexities of love, loss, and the human condition. Through vivid imagery and evocative language, she transports readers to a realm where emotions run deep and the boundaries between reality and imagination blur. From the titular poem's poignant journey to the ethereal landscapes of "The Song of the Brook, " Cone's poetry invites us to delve into the depths of our own hearts and experience the transformative power of the written word.
